I lead Medicaid operations, government technology, compliance, and cross-agency delivery for public assistance programs.
What I'm looking for
I lead Medicaid operations, compliance, policy implementation, and government technology initiatives that improve delivery for public assistance programs. Through J Mountain Consulting, I manage concurrent client projects, translate new requirements into practical workflows, and develop funding strategies that expand healthcare access.
At the Colorado Governor’s Office of Information Technology, I led infrastructure initiatives supporting approximately 6,000 county human services users across 64 counties. I directed vendor agreements, resolved delivery and compliance issues, and led a four-month effort that remediated more than 8,000 security vulnerabilities.
Previously at Colorado HCPF, I coordinated state agencies, counties, vendors, and technical teams around system risk and operational gaps. I secured $1.25M in ARPA funding for statewide human services record digitization and helped deliver Tableau dashboards for oversight and continuous improvement.
